Story summary
- Israel's home prices have fallen for eight consecutive months, down 2.6% over the period and 0.5% in September and October.
- High interest rates and shifting demand drive the downturn.
- In October, sales of new and secondhand apartments fell 14% and 10%, respectively.
- Total October sales were 4,518 apartments, down 12% from the previous year.
- Some foreign residents still consider buying, with Jerusalem accounting for 44% of foreign purchases.
